Class conflict and class consciousness

open access: green, 1978
The working class in the Ruhr was in the process of formation throughout this period, with considerable migration into the area from many parts of Germany and abroad. Mobility was also high within the Ruhr. The result was that the working class was unsettled and unhomogenous.
